Chain mails like this present three immediate and obvious problems in the area of persuasion that aren't worth the trouble.

First, there's no need to send it to the already converted, that 1/3 of the electorate always on your side. Secondly, it has such obvious flaws that even the rare truly open minded liberal will not only reject it but deservedly he suspicious of anything you ever say about the issue in the future.

And the seekers not driven by partisanship will research it and reject it and question your intelligence, honesty or both.

I've literally never had one of these persuade me.
